Si tu sistema es lento, falla bajo carga o no escala, el problema casi siempre está en la base de datos. Una auditoría de rendimiento permite detectar cuellos de botella y optimizar la arquitectura para reducir costes y mejorar la eficiencia.
El problema real: sistemas que crecen sin base sólida
Muchas empresas desarrollan sus sistemas digitales sin una arquitectura de datos bien definida. Al principio todo funciona correctamente, pero a medida que el negocio crece, empiezan a aparecer problemas de rendimiento.
Consultas lentas, tiempos de carga elevados o errores bajo alta demanda son síntomas claros de una base de datos mal optimizada. Estos problemas no solo afectan a la experiencia del usuario, sino que impactan directamente en la operativa del negocio.
Desde una perspectiva empresarial, esto genera una pérdida de eficiencia y un aumento de costes. Más servidores, más recursos y más tiempo invertido en solucionar problemas que podrían haberse evitado con una arquitectura adecuada.
Qué es una auditoría de rendimiento de bases de datos
Una auditoría de bases de datos es un análisis técnico profundo que evalúa cómo está estructurado y funcionando el sistema de datos de una empresa.
El objetivo no es solo detectar errores, sino identificar ineficiencias estructurales. Esto incluye revisar consultas SQL, índices, relaciones entre tablas, diseño del esquema y uso de recursos.
En términos de negocio, esta auditoría permite optimizar el sistema para que soporte crecimiento sin incrementar costes de forma desproporcionada. Es decir, se construye una base escalable.
Por qué el problema no es la tecnología, sino la arquitectura
Uno de los errores más comunes es pensar que el problema se soluciona aumentando recursos: más CPU, más RAM o servidores más potentes. Sin embargo, esto solo oculta el problema.
Cuando la arquitectura de la base de datos es ineficiente, el sistema consume más recursos de los necesarios. Esto genera lo que se conoce como deuda técnica: decisiones mal planteadas que incrementan el coste operativo a largo plazo.
Optimizar la arquitectura permite reducir esta deuda. Se mejora el rendimiento sin necesidad de aumentar infraestructura, lo que impacta directamente en la rentabilidad.
Solicitar auditoría de base de datos
Componentes clave que analiza una auditoría
Una auditoría de rendimiento no es superficial. Se centra en elementos críticos que afectan al funcionamiento del sistema.
Consultas SQL
Se analizan las consultas más utilizadas para detectar ineficiencias. Consultas mal optimizadas pueden consumir recursos innecesarios y ralentizar el sistema.
Índices
Los índices permiten acceder a los datos de forma más rápida. Sin embargo, un mal uso puede generar el efecto contrario. La auditoría identifica qué índices son necesarios y cuáles sobran.
Diseño del esquema
La estructura de tablas y relaciones debe estar optimizada para el uso real del sistema. Un diseño incorrecto puede limitar el rendimiento.
Uso de recursos
Se analiza cómo se utilizan CPU, memoria y almacenamiento. Esto permite identificar cuellos de botella.
Cada uno de estos elementos tiene un impacto directo en la eficiencia del sistema.
Impacto en el negocio: rendimiento, costes y escalabilidad
Optimizar una base de datos no es solo una mejora técnica, es una decisión estratégica.
En primer lugar, mejora el rendimiento del sistema. Esto se traduce en tiempos de respuesta más rápidos y mejor experiencia de usuario, lo que puede aumentar conversiones y retención.
En segundo lugar, reduce costes. Un sistema optimizado necesita menos recursos para funcionar, lo que disminuye el gasto en infraestructura.
Finalmente, permite escalar. Una arquitectura bien diseñada soporta crecimiento sin necesidad de rehacer el sistema.
Desde un punto de vista de ROI, esto convierte la optimización en una inversión con retorno claro.
Señales de que necesitas una auditoría de base de datos
Existen indicadores claros que muestran que algo no está funcionando correctamente.
Lentitud en el sistema
Si las operaciones tardan más de lo esperado, es probable que existan problemas de optimización.
Errores bajo carga
Cuando el sistema falla con muchos usuarios, la base de datos suele ser el cuello de botella.
Costes elevados de infraestructura
Si necesitas aumentar recursos constantemente, puede haber ineficiencias.
Dificultad para escalar
Si cada crecimiento implica rehacer partes del sistema, la arquitectura no es adecuada.
Detectar estas señales a tiempo evita problemas mayores.
Precios de auditoría de bases de datos en 2026
El coste de una auditoría depende del tamaño del sistema y la complejidad.
Auditoría básica
Entre 500€ y 1.500€. Incluye análisis general y recomendaciones.
Auditoría avanzada
Entre 1.500€ y 5.000€. Incluye análisis detallado, pruebas y plan de optimización.
Optimización completa
Puede superar los 5.000€, dependiendo del alcance. Incluye implementación de mejoras.
Es importante entender que el coste depende del valor generado. Una optimización puede reducir significativamente los costes operativos.
Errores comunes en bases de datos empresariales
Muchos problemas se repiten en diferentes empresas.
Falta de índices adecuados
Genera consultas lentas y consumo excesivo de recursos.
Diseño no normalizado
Provoca redundancias y dificulta el mantenimiento.
Consultas ineficientes
Aumentan el tiempo de respuesta y el uso de CPU.
Escalabilidad no prevista
El sistema no está preparado para crecer.
Evitar estos errores es clave para mantener la eficiencia.
Cómo abordar la optimización de forma estratégica
La optimización debe seguir un proceso estructurado.
Primero se analiza el estado actual mediante la auditoría. Después se identifican los puntos críticos y se priorizan las mejoras. Finalmente, se implementan cambios y se monitoriza el rendimiento.
Este enfoque permite mejorar el sistema de forma progresiva sin afectar la operativa del negocio.
Además, es importante integrar la optimización en la estrategia tecnológica. No es un proceso puntual, sino continuo.
Hablar con arquitecto de software
El papel de la arquitectura escalable
Una base de datos optimizada no solo funciona mejor, sino que está preparada para el futuro.
La arquitectura escalable permite gestionar aumentos de volumen sin pérdida de rendimiento. Esto es clave en negocios digitales, donde el crecimiento puede ser rápido.
Diseñar con escalabilidad en mente evita rehacer sistemas en el futuro, lo que reduce costes y mejora la eficiencia.
Preguntas frecuentes sobre optimización de bases de datos
¿Cuánto tiempo tarda una auditoría?
Depende del sistema, pero puede ir de días a semanas.
¿Es necesario parar el sistema?
No, normalmente se realiza sin afectar la operativa.
¿Qué base de datos se puede optimizar?
Cualquier sistema relacional, como MySQL, PostgreSQL o SQL Server.
¿Se notan los resultados rápidamente?
Sí, especialmente en sistemas con problemas evidentes.
¿Es mejor optimizar o cambiar de tecnología?
En la mayoría de casos, optimizar es suficiente.
¿Se puede evitar la deuda técnica?
Sí, con una arquitectura bien diseñada desde el inicio.